加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zz.com.cn/)- 语音技术、视频终端、数据开发、人脸识别、智能机器人!
当前位置: 首页 > 教程 > 正文

编解码开发全攻略:编程实现与高效设计优化解析

发布时间:2026-02-10 09:06:31 所属栏目:教程 来源:DaWei
导读:  编解码技术在现代计算机系统中扮演着至关重要的角色,无论是数据传输、存储还是信息处理,都离不开高效的编码与解码机制。理解编解码的基本原理是实现和优化的基础。  编程实现编解码功能通常涉及选择合适的算

  编解码技术在现代计算机系统中扮演着至关重要的角色,无论是数据传输、存储还是信息处理,都离不开高效的编码与解码机制。理解编解码的基本原理是实现和优化的基础。


  编程实现编解码功能通常涉及选择合适的算法和数据结构。例如,常见的编码方式包括ASCII、UTF-8、Base64等,而解码则需要根据编码规则进行逆向操作。开发者应根据具体需求选择最合适的方案。


  在实际开发中,代码的可读性和可维护性同样重要。良好的注释和模块化设计能够提高团队协作效率,减少后期维护成本。同时,测试用例的全面覆盖也是确保编解码正确性的关键。


AI生成结论图,仅供参考

  高效的设计优化主要体现在性能提升和资源管理上。通过使用更高效的算法或缓存机制,可以显著减少处理时间和内存占用。合理利用硬件特性,如并行计算或GPU加速,也能进一步提升编解码效率。


  在面对复杂场景时,考虑错误处理和异常恢复机制显得尤为重要。编解码过程中可能会遇到无效输入或格式错误,合理的异常捕获和日志记录有助于快速定位问题并保障系统稳定性。


  持续学习和关注行业动态也是保持竞争力的关键。随着技术的发展,新的编解码标准和工具不断涌现,开发者应保持开放心态,及时更新知识体系。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章